‘Neither Richards Nor Bradman’: Kohli, Rohit Advised to Follow Yuvraj Singh’s Example

The star players have suffered from poor performances and had a tough tour to Australia, in which India lost 1-3. After their disappointing displays in red-ball cricket, multiple former cricketers have advised them to play some Ranji Trophy matches. Yograj has joined the bandwagon and said that "no one is bigger than cricket, not even legends like Viv Richards or Don Bradman."

Yograj further explained that if Kohli and Sharma take part in the Ranji Trophy, it will further benefit the younger players, who will have the opportunity to rub shoulders with these two seniors.
“You can never become bigger than the game. Neither Viv Richards nor Don Bradman, they were never bigger than cricket and neither can anyone become. So what you do is you come back from the tours, you must start playing domestic cricket. When Test players play domestic cricket, then the rest of the youngsters playing with them get a lot of confidence,” Yograj told ANI.
In the meantime, Rohit confirmed that he will play Mumbai's next Ranji Trophy match against Jammu and Kashmir, while Kohli has pulled out of Delhi's match due to a neck sprain. The former India captain last played a Ranji Trophy match back in 2012 against Uttar Pradesh at Mohan Nagar in Ghaziabad. There are only two star batters: Kohli and KL Rahul from Karnataka, missing from the Ranji Trophy because it is obligatory by the Board of Control for Cricket in India to play it.

‘Yuvraj Singh used to go and play Ranji Trophy’
Yograj went on to say that around this time Yuvraj used to play Ranji matches when he was not a part of the Indian squad, and insisted that Rohit and Kohli should take advantage of this free time, as practicing in the nets does little to help someone like them.
“Whenever Yuvi (Yuvraj Singh) all the time when he was not in the Indian squad, he used to go and play Ranji Trophy. When the team was not playing any tournament. So, I think this is one thing that they should come and play, all of them, Rohit Sharma and Virat Kohli. There should be a fitness camp for the players. Nothing happens in the nets, everything happens in centre,” he added.
